查询短信模板

请求参数

参数 类型 描述 是否必须 示例 提示
Methods String 请求方法 TemplateQuery 查询短信模板
TemplateID String 短信模板ID 10110 由Template_Add返回

请求示例


POST /SDK3/Sms HTTP/1.1
Host: sms.mobset.com:8095
Content-Type: application/x-www-form-urlencoded
Content-Length: 135

CorpID=100000&LoginName=fuyj&SecretKey=95e8c1a7520ee6be5e799057da490885&TimeStamp=20230925170000&Methods=TemplateQuery&TemplateID=10110


OkHttpClient client = new OkHttpClient().newBuilder()
  .build();
MediaType mediaType = MediaType.parse("application/x-www-form-urlencoded");
RequestBody body = RequestBody.create(mediaType, "CorpID=100000&LoginName=fuyj&SecretKey=95e8c1a7520ee6be5e799057da490885&TimeStamp=20230925170000&Methods=TemplateQuery&TemplateID=10110");
Request request = new Request.Builder()
  .url("http://sms.mobset.com:8095/SDK3/Sms")
  .method("POST", body)
  .addHeader("Content-Type", "application/x-www-form-urlencoded")
  .build();
Response response = client.newCall(request).execute();
	

setUrl('http://sms.mobset.com:8095/SDK3/Sms');
$request->setMethod(HTTP_Request2::METHOD_POST);
$request->setConfig(array(
  'follow_redirects' => TRUE
));
$request->setHeader(array(
  'Content-Type' => 'application/x-www-form-urlencoded'
));
$request->addPostParameter(array(
  'CorpID' => '100000',
  'LoginName' => 'fuyj',
  'SecretKey' => '95e8c1a7520ee6be5e799057da490885',
  'TimeStamp' => '20230925170000',
  'Methods' => 'TemplateQuery',
  'TemplateID' => '10110'
));
try {
  $response = $request->send();
  if ($response->getStatus() == 200) {
    echo $response->getBody();
  }
  else {
    echo 'Unexpected HTTP status: ' . $response->getStatus() . ' ' .
    $response->getReasonPhrase();
  }
}
catch(HTTP_Request2_Exception $e) {
  echo 'Error: ' . $e->getMessage();
}


var client = new RestClient("http://sms.mobset.com:8095/SDK3/Sms");
client.Timeout = -1;
var request = new RestRequest(Method.POST);
request.AddHeader("Content-Type", "application/x-www-form-urlencoded");
request.AddParameter("CorpID", "100000");
request.AddParameter("LoginName", "fuyj");
request.AddParameter("SecretKey", "95e8c1a7520ee6be5e799057da490885");
request.AddParameter("TimeStamp", "20230925170000");
request.AddParameter("Methods", "TemplateQuery");
request.AddParameter("TemplateID", "10110");
IRestResponse response = client.Execute(request);
Console.WriteLine(response.Content);

返回参数

 返回类型

  JSON
参数 示例 描述
Code 1 =1 短信模板查询成功
<0 提交失败,具体原因请查询错误代码汇总表。
Message 查询短信模板成功 代码中文提示
Template 模板信息
TemplateID 10115 短信模板ID
Status 1 状态,0-待审核;1-审核成功;2-审核失败。
TemplateType 1 模板类型,1-应用模板;2-营销模板。
TemplateName 首易应用模板 模板名称。
TemplateContent 你注册{1}应用的验证码为{2},有效时间{3}分钟。验证码请不要告诉其它人! 模板内容
Remark 备注 备注
AuditOpinion 短信参数不符合规范 审核意见
IsTemporary 1 是否临时模板:0-永久模板,1-临时模板。如为临时模板,7天后系统会自动删除。
CreateTime/td> 2023-10-01 10:30:00 创建时间

返回示例

{
    "code": "1",
    "Message": "查询短信模板成功",
    "Template": [{
      "TemplateID": 10115,
      "Status": 1,
      "TemplateType": 1,
      "TemplateName": "测试"
      "TemplateContent": "你注册{1}应用的验证码为{2},有效时间{3}分钟。验证码请不要告诉其它人!"
      "Remark": "测试"
      "AuditOpinion": ""
      "IsTemporary": 0
      "CreateTime": "2022-05-13 16:26:19"
    }]
}